How they compare
Haiti currently reports 53.7% against 52.5% in Bangladesh, a difference of 1.2%.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 6 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Haiti ahead.
Bangladesh ranks 12th and Haiti ranks 9th of 185 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Bangladesh averaged higher in 1 and Haiti in 2.

About this data
Number of deaths ages 5-14 due to injury divided by number of all deaths ages 5-14, expressed by percentage. Injury includes unintentional and intentional injuries.
